Bangladesh blocks Myanmar’s Muslim refugees from SIM cards

As Myanmar’s Muslim minority escape a humanitarian crisis to Bangladesh, they’re finding new problems in their new home. The Bangladeshi government, citing security concerns, has banned its carriers from selling SIM cards to Rohingya refugees, reports AFP. Anyone flouting the rule will face a fine. Opera’s latest developer update adds support for VR playback

Opera is jumping onto the VR bandwagon. Opera Developer 49, the browser’s latest developer update, lets you watch all videos online using an embedded feature called the VR 360 player, the company said in a blogpost today. China, India among first in Asia to get the iPhone X

The new iPhones, Apple TV and Apple Watch are coming to Asia, and they will arrive the same time as in the US. If you’re living in Bahrain, China, Hong Kong, India, Japan, Singapore and Taiwan, preorders for the iPhone X (as in “ten”) will begin on Oct. 27 and the device will arrive in stores Nov. 3.
